Buying Guide: Fabric Hair Bows For Practical Purchase Decisions

What fabric should I choose for comfort and hair health?

Soft fabrics such as linen, cotton blends, and waffle weave are gentle on the scalp and minimize tangling. Look for breathable materials that lessen pulling and irritation, especially for sensitive or very young hair.

How important is clip strength and size?

Clip strength determines hold in various hair types. Alligator clips that grip securely without snagging are ideal for thick or slippery hair. For toddlers or fine hair, opt for clips with gentler pressure or a removable clip option for versatility.

Is DIY crafting a good approach for long-term value?

DIY or kits provide customization and ongoing projects, which can be cost-effective if you enjoy making accessories. They’re best for crafters who want to experiment with textures, colors, and styles rather than immediate, mass-produced bows.

What size bow is most versatile?

A around 3.3 to 4 inches bow is typically versatile for daily wear, ponytails, and braids. Larger sizes suit special occasions, while smaller bows are ideal for adding subtle accents to outfits.

Are these fabric bows suitable for birthdays or photos?

Yes. Fabric bows add a soft, tactile look in photos and can complement outfits for celebrations. When buying for photos, consider color coordination with clothing and the overall theme of the shoot.

How do I care for fabric bows?

Light cleaning with a soft cloth and mild soap is usually enough. For bows that include glitter or faux leather, follow material-specific care instructions to prevent peeling or fringing. Avoid machine washing when possible to preserve edges and clips.
